With Thesis 1.6 bloggers can quickly change the color and overall look to their sites without using CSS code. Color controls and other tweaks include:

  • Site background color
  • Content color
  • Nav bar links and background color
  • Footer color
  • Sidebar color
  • Header background and text color
  • Headline text color
  • Multimedia box color, image box color
  • Width of content box and sidebars (if you choose to use them)
  • Display full post or post excerpts
  • Magazine style blog (see front page)
  • Easily visit related Thesis links within the WordPress dashboard
  • Change front and sizes on every aspect of your site

Other features:

thesis preview

  • Remove all borders with one click
  • Drop down navigation menu
  • Custom file editor lets you edit custom.css and custom_function.php files within the wordpress dash!
